Solution Overview

Problem

Existing boat deck recliners are permanently secured to the deck, making them expensive, non-portable, and unavailable as aftermarket add-ons, limiting their accessibility and versatility.

Innovation Solution

A foldable recliner device that is non-invasively secured to the boat deck, allowing for easy removal and reinstallation on different boats, with adjustable backrest and sunpad options for enhanced usability.

1Stability of the object's composition

If recliners are permanently secured to the boat deck, then stability and fixed position are improved, but portability and adaptability deteriorate

Solution Approach 1:

The recliner is divided into separate components: a base section with deck attachment mechanism, a backrest section with hinge connection, and an optional sunpad section. This segmentation allows each part to be independently assembled and disassembled, enabling the recliner to be securely installed when needed while also being easily removed and transported to different boats.

Solution Approach 2:

The recliner incorporates dynamic elements including a hinge mechanism allowing the backrest to recline at multiple angles, and a quick-release attachment system that transitions the device from a fixed installed state to a portable carried state. The backrest can dynamically adjust between upright and reclined positions while installed.

Data Source

PatentUS20250042516A1Foldable recliner device for boat deck
Publication Date: 2025.02.06 TARDIF JEAN MARC

AI summary

A foldable recliner device for a boat deck has a seat section releasably securable to the boat deck and a back section hingeably mounted on the seat section, between a folded configuration with the back section generally folded against the seat section and an open configuration with the back section extending from the seat section and forming an angle therebetween larger than zero degree (0°) and up to one hundred and eighty degrees (180°). The back section includes a backrest portion, an arch portion, and a retainer portion. The backrest portion and the retainer portion are hingeably mounted on the seat section and are independently movable relative to one another. The arch portion is hingeably mounted on the backrest portion and removably connects to the retainer portion when in the open configuration.
